  • Unclaimed Property - connects you to the unclaimed property program of every state. "Unclaimed property" occurs when the holder of the asset (bank accounts, uncashed travelers' checks, utility refunds, stock certificates, insurance proceeds) cannot locate the owner within a certain period of time and must turn it over to the states.

  • Probate Courts - deal with the estate of someone who has died. The Court supervises the estate's administration, probates wills, oversees numerous kinds of testamentary and living trusts and so forth. In many states, it also deals with adoptions, name changes, conservatorships, guardianship of minors, termination of parental rights, partition of property, marriage licenses. It may also be referred to as Surrogate Court.
